Cosmog is a small {{OBP|Pokémon|species}} with a gaseous body similar to a {{wp|nebula}}. The gases that make up its body range in color from violet to light blue. The very center of its body is black both in front and back. The black space on the front contains its face, which consists of beady yellow eyes, circular blue cheeks, and a small mouth. The space on the back has only a single blue dot. There is a golden half-circlet on both the top and bottom half of its body, which divides it exactly in half. Two wispy extensions containing starry specks serve as its arms. Cosmog's gaseous body makes it one of the [[List of Pokémon by weight|lightest Pokémon]] in existence.

Cosmog's body is frail and easily blown away. However, it is carefree and doesn't seem to mind. It collects dust from the atmosphere, which allows it to grow slowly. Cosmog has the ability to warp itself and those close to it, as well as open [[Ultra Wormhole]]s, but only when under stress. This process is very dangerous for Cosmog, and the use of its powers can leave it immobile for extended periods of time. Cosmog is theorized by the [[Aether Foundation]] to be a type of [[Ultra Beast]], and its name was coined by one of the professors at the Foundation. In ages past, it was known as the “child of the stars”. In behavior, Cosmog has an overly trusting nature and it immediately takes a liking to whoever shows it kindness, even when that person doesn't have the best intentions for it.<ref>[http://www.pokemon-sunmoon.com/en-ca/pokemon/cosmog/ Pokémon Sun and Moon site | Cosmog]</ref> Cosmog is known to be very curious but not very cautious, this behavior has often lead to Cosmog being willing to put itself in danger, only to teleport away in case things get dicey. This Pokémon can be created by {{p|Solgaleo}} and {{p|Lunala}}.

* Cosmog has the lowest base stat total of all [[Legendary Pokémon]].
* Cosmog and its {{p|Cosmoem|evolution}} are the only Pokémon who are unable to damage an opponent outside of {{m|Struggle}}.
* Cosmog has the smallest movepool of all Legendary Pokémon, with only two [[move]]s that it can learn.
* Since it cannot learn any attacking moves, Cosmog's attack animation is only seen in {{pkmn|battle}} if a Pokémon with {{a|Illusion}} is disguised as Cosmog and uses an attacking move. However, this animation can be viewed in the [[Pokédex]], the [[Alola Photo Club]], [[Pokémon Camp]], and [[Pokémon HOME]].

* Cosmog's evolution into Cosmoem has the greatest {{wp|standard deviation}} of all Pokémon, with 47.14, meaning that the changes to its base stats on evolving are the most uneven of all Pokémon.
